Summary
If you make CHF 24'369'432 a year living in the region of Zurich, Switzerland, you will be taxed CHF 11'450'843. That means that your net pay will be CHF 12'918'589 per year, or CHF 1'076'549 per month. Your average tax rate is 47.0% and your marginal tax rate is 47.1%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of CHF 100 in your salary will be taxed CHF 47.08, hence, your net pay will only increase by CHF 52.92.
Bonus Example
A CHF 1'000 bonus will generate an extra CHF 529 of net incomes. A CHF 5'000 bonus will generate an extra CHF 2'646 of net incomes.
